1300 <br />License <br />S$LECTM9x } S MEED ING <br />Aug. 19, 1940, <br />A regular meeting of the Board of Selectmen was held <br />in the Selectmen's Room, Town Office Building, Lexington, <br />at 7:30 P.M. Chairman Giroux, Messrs. Potter, Rowse, Locke <br />and Sarano were present. The Assistant;Clerk was also <br />present. <br />At 7t3O P.M. Mr. Morse appeared before the Board to <br />discuss welfare matters. He retired at StOO P.M. <br />Upon motion of Mr. Locke, seconded by Mr. Potter, it <br />was voted to grant the following licensees <br />Frank Ready - 1760 Mass. Ave. - Overhanging sign. <br />William Viano - 3794 Mass. Ave. - Theatre License <br />The Board signed an amendment to the Traffic Regula. <br />Traffic tions prohibiting parking on Waltham Street, on the <br />regulation easterly side from a point 160 feet from the southerly <br />side of Mass. Ave. to the northerly side of Vine Brook Rd. <br />At 8x15 P.M. Mr. John Lamont, Health Inspector, <br />appeared before the Board. Mr. Lamont stated that at the <br />last meeting he had reported to the Board the work he has <br />J <br />Letter was received from the Town Treasurer suggest - <br />Ing a borrowing of $75,000* in anticipation of revenue, <br />Loan <br />the notes to be dated Aug. 23, 1940 and payable Aug. 22, <br />1941. <br />Mr. Carroll appeared before the Board and stated that <br />there were notes of $125,000* coming due the first of the <br />month and this was the reason for the suggested loan. <br />Mr. Potter moved that the Board authorizing the <br />borrowing of $75,000. in anticipation of revenue, the <br />notes to be dated Aug. 23, 1940 and payable Aug. 220 1941s <br />the bids to be received on Aug. 22, 1940 at 4t30 P,M. Mr. <br />Rowse seconded the motion and it was so voted. <br />Letter of thanks was received from Mrs. Gertrude E. <br />Letter of <br />Mara for the Board's expression of sympathy during their <br />thanks* <br />recent bereavement, <br />Letter of thanks was received from W.S. Caouette for <br />the cooperation he had received from the town and its <br />officials in connection with the Pollen Hill Eetates. <br />At 8x15 P.M.
